Summary Responsible for the efficient and safe operation and quality of an assigned section of machines. Description Checks the daily dept. schedules for any changes, repairs, special instructions, or other tasks. Sets and monitors machine controls, sets machine blenders, regulates temperatures, volume of plastics, and monitors pressure and time. Maintains all mc's as per control standards, and ensures that the monitor, plug, cycle sheets and any other documentation are updated and accurate. Ensures the quality of products meet or exceed the standards. Investigates, repairs or plugs off any quality defects, cleans system of any defective parts and re-qualifies the process for accepted production. Perform color, material, board shots, and repair shots as per schedule. Checks the mc's, mold, and auxiliary equipment to maintain proper running condition and submits a maintenance work ticket as needed. Controls all waste, scrap, and regrind. Keeps mc's and dept. in a clean and safe condition. Communicates with out-going shift personnel for any problems or assignments to be completed. Responsible for the gross visual inspection, packaging, labeling and material handling for the injection molding parts. Boxes/ totes are to be removed from parts chutes at the mc once it is filled. Parts are to be correctly labeled, free of mixed parts and free of visual defects. Samples are to be delivered to inspection on time and attendant advises inspectors when a defect is detected visually. Performs other duties and responsibilities as assigned.
